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737 Форумы портала PHP.SU :: не могу зарегестрировать пользователя
Покинул форум
Сообщений всего: 36
Дата рег-ции: Нояб. 2010
Помог: 0 раз(а)
Здраствуйте!!! подскажите пожалуйста почему при авторизации вечно выводит пароль не верен..? хотя я уверен что ввожу правильные значения... даже когда пустые значения ввожу, то все равно пароль не верен, хотя должно выдавать логин или пароль не указан... Целый день ломаю голову и что то ни как не могу понять...
Покинул форум
Сообщений всего: 7540
Дата рег-ции: Янв. 2010 Откуда: Чернигов
Помог: 299 раз(а)
переменые $login и $password в запросе не определены.
----- Если вы хотя бы 3-4 раза не решите всё выкинуть и начать заново - вы явно что-то делаете не так.
lancer5610
Отправлено: 18 Декабря, 2010 - 17:24:55
Новичок
Покинул форум
Сообщений всего: 36
Дата рег-ции: Нояб. 2010
Помог: 0 раз(а)
OrmaJever пишет:
переменые $login и $password в запросе не определены.
Что то не понял... Как это они не определены? строка 20 и 21... там они и определены и там им присваиваються значения из форм...
Поясните пожалуйста...
garvey
Отправлено: 18 Декабря, 2010 - 17:25:11
Частый посетитель
Покинул форум
Сообщений всего: 528
Дата рег-ции: Май 2010 Откуда: Minsk
Помог: 3 раз(а)
Очень страшный код. Ошибки:
1. if ($login = '' or $password = '') => if ($login == '' or $password == '')
2. Экранируйте запросы. mysql_real_escape_string()
3. И многое другое.
Все гости форума могут просматривать этот раздел. Только зарегистрированные пользователи могут создавать новые темы в этом разделе.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.